Using a Headset
For KX-UT133/KX-UT136, if a headset is connected,
you must enable Headset mode using the Headset
button (flexible button).
To enable Headset mode, press the Headset button
(flexible button). When in Headset mode, [SP-PHONE/
] is used for going on- and off-hook.

Setting Up the Unit
This section explains the settings that you can configure
when you start the unit.
Accessing the start-up settings
1.
Connect the unit to an Ethernet cable capable of
delivering power (PoE compliant), or use an
optional AC adaptor to supply power.
2.
Connect the unit to the network.
3.
On the start-up screen, press
4.
Select the item for the settings you want to
configure.
